Trump's Gaza Proposal Shakes Israeli Politics

US President Donald Trump's proposal for US control of the Gaza Strip, supported by 72% of Israelis in a poll but deemed unrealistic by 65%, has created uncertainty in Israel regarding its implications for a recent three-stage ceasefire with Hamas and the ambitions of the far-right.

Gaza Famine Averted, but Truce Remains Fragile

The UN reports that a surge in aid to Gaza following a January 19 ceasefire has largely averted famine, but warns that the threat could return quickly if the truce collapses; over 12,600 aid trucks have entered Gaza since the ceasefire began.
